
Historical Data
Historical data refers to past information collected over time, such as sales figures, weather patterns, or financial records. It provides context and insight into trends, patterns, and changes that have occurred previously. By analyzing this data, businesses, researchers, and individuals can make informed decisions, forecast future outcomes, and identify areas for improvement. Essentially, historical data serves as a record of what has happened, helping us learn from the past to better understand the present and plan for the future.
